M25 / London / Suffolk Patch

Up to £42,000 Basic (£50,000+ OTE) + Door-to-Door Pay + Company Van + Overtime + Call-Out Rota (1 in 4) + Training + Progression

Are you a Field Service Engineer with experience working on pumps and a strong electrical background, looking for a stable, well-paid role within a market-leading, close-knit business that offers specialisation?

How to prepare for a job interview at Ernest Gordon Recruitment

✨Know Your Pumps and Electrical Systems

Make sure you brush up on your technical knowledge about pumps and electrical systems. Be ready to discuss specific models you've worked with and any troubleshooting experiences. This will show that you’re not just familiar with the basics but have hands-on experience.

✨Demonstrate Problem-Solving Skills

Prepare to share examples of how you've tackled challenges in the field. Think of situations where you had to diagnose a problem quickly or implement a solution under pressure. This will highlight your ability to think on your feet, which is crucial for a Field Service Engineer.

✨Show Enthusiasm for Training and Progression

The company values growth and development, so express your eagerness to learn and advance in your career. Mention any relevant training you've undertaken or certifications you're interested in pursuing. This shows that you’re committed to improving your skills and contributing to the team.

✨Ask Insightful Questions

Prepare a few thoughtful questions about the role, the team, or the company's future projects. This not only demonstrates your interest in the position but also gives you a chance to assess if the company aligns with your career goals. It’s a win-win!
